About The Position

160 Driving Academy is seeking experienced CDL A Drivers to transition into CDL instructors. This local position offers structured training and support to prepare individuals for the instructor role. With 150 locations across 43 states, the academy provides career stability and potential relocation opportunities. The core of the role involves leveraging driving experience to train and mentor the next generation of truck drivers, ensuring they are skilled and prepared for the industry.

Requirements

  • Must reside in the state you are applying for or have a residence secured for relocation.
  • Valid CDL Class A license with a minimum of 24 months of verifiable tractor-trailer driving experience.
  • Safe driving record and ability to pass DOT physical and drug/alcohol screening.
  • Strong communication and leadership skills with the ability to mentor students.
  • Basic computer skills to track student progress and scheduling.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ience in mentoring, coaching, or training drivers.
  • Driver Training Instructor certification (If required by the state, we provide guidance and support to help you obtain this certification.)
  • Knowledge of FMCSA and state regulations related to CDL training and testing.
  • Ability to adapt instruction for different learning styles.

Responsibilities

  • Teach students CDL A driving skills through classroom instruction and hands-on training.
  • Provide step-by-step guidance in pre-trip inspections, yard maneuvers, and road driving.
  • Ensure students understand CDL testing standards and are fully prepared for the exam.
  • Promote safety, professionalism, and industry best practices in all training.
  • Track student attendance and progress, providing additional support when needed.
  • Maintain proper documentation, including student evaluations and training records.
  • Work collaboratively with other instructors to provide an effective training experience.
